What is quantum computing?

A Quantum Computing job involves researching, developing, and applying quantum mechanics principles to create advanced computing systems. Professionals in this field work on algorithms, hardware, and software that leverage quantum bits (qubits) to solve complex problems faster than classical computers. Roles include quantum software engineer, quantum physicist, and research scientist, often requiring expertise in physics, mathematics, and computer science. These jobs are typically found in academia, tech companies, and government research labs focused on advancing quantum technology.

What does someone working in quantum computing do?

Professionals in quantum computing spend their days developing and testing quantum algorithms, collaborating with physicists and engineers on hardware advancements, and running experiments on quantum simulators or actual devices. They often work in interdisciplinary teams and engage in regular code reviews, technical discussions, and research collaborations. Keeping up with the latest scientific literature and participating in internal or external seminars is also common. This dynamic workflow ensures that team members stay informed about cutting-edge developments and continuously contribute to innovative projects.

What are the key skills and qualifications needed to thrive in quantum computing?

To thrive in quantum computing, you typically need a strong background in physics, mathematics, and computer science, often supported by a graduate degree in a relevant field. Familiarity with quantum programming languages (such as Qiskit or Cirq), quantum hardware platforms, and experience with simulation tools are frequently required. Analytical thinking, problem-solving, and the ability to communicate complex concepts clearly are valuable soft skills. These competencies are essential for developing and implementing quantum algorithms, collaborating on interdisciplinary teams, and advancing this rapidly evolving field.

Job City & State Raleigh, NC-27606 Position Overview Essential Job Duties The Department of Electrical Engineering (College of Engineering) and the College of Sciences (Department of Physics, Department of Mathematics) are searching for two (2) Postdoctoral Research Scholars in quantum computing at NC State University. The two positions will work synergistically on hybrid continuous-discrete-variable quantum computing, broadly defined. One position will focus on condensed matter physics, quantum simulation; the other position will focus on compilation, benchmark, and HPC simulation of quantum circuits. The postdocs will work with a cluster of vibrant quantum computing faculty at NC State, including Dr. Bojko Bakalov, Professor (Mathematics), Dr. Dror Baron (Electrical and Computer Engineering), Lex Kemper (Physics), Yuan Liu (Electrical and Computer Engineering, Computer Science, and Physics), Frank Mueller (Computer Science), and Huiyang Zhou (Electrical and Computer Engineering), with possible external collaborations with other universities and national lab. Other Duties and Responsibilities
  • Explore relevant parameter regions for useful boson-fermi mixed quantum matter; Design, develop, and implement novel quantum algorithms to simulate them.
  • Quantify resource requirements on simulation on hybrid CD-DV quantum processors under noise, and compare to qubit-based quantum computers;
  • Explore compilation, benchmarking, HPC simulation, error mitigation, and error correction strategies on hybrid CV-DV quantum processors;
  • Collaborate with multidisciplinary teams to understand domain-specific requirements and integrate discoveries into the team's mission;
  • Help to lead the project and mentor junior researchers;
  • Publish research findings in reputable journals and conferences

North Carolina State University (NCSU), located in Raleigh, NC, US, is a leading educational institution with a strong emphasis on research, academics, and public service. Established in 1887, NCSU operates in the education industry and endeavors to foster student success, and promote economic development by providing high-quality, affordable education, and conducting groundbreaking research across a variety of disciplines. With more than 100 majors, its academic offerings range from undergraduates to postgraduates along with doctoral studies - in various fields like engineering, natural resources, humanities, and social sciences. NCSU is firmly anchored on the core values of respect, responsibility, integrity, and innovation. Its mission is to create economic, societal, and intellectual prosperity for the people of North Carolina and the nation.
